Do you re-up every 2 years to get a new phone? If so, then you are on a contract and they can't change the terms of the contract (raise the price) until the contract has ended.

Both my dh and I have prepaid phone plans. He has straight talk and I have T-Mobile and really like them. He pays 45 per month for unlimited everything and has never had any problems. Yes you have to pay for the phone but we didnt like the idea of being locked into a contract for 2 years and honestly the cost savings over two years more then makes up for the price of the phone. We both have Androids and they work great, I can't see ever paying what some people I know pay for their monthly cell bills!

As previously stated, Straight Talk uses the VZW network for all phones except for Android smartphones (those phones are supported by the Sprint nationwide network).
